Lean: mixedThe tape is mixed: the higher-quality long thesis is still AI storage scarcity and supplier pricing power, but late-week action shifted sharply toward de-risking. The important change was the July 2 breakdown cluster, with multiple authors flagging memory/storage weakness, 50DMA breaks, and put flow after earlier risk-on leadership. Trade structure implies crowded long exposure is being tested rather than a clean fundamental rejection.
Bulls argue STX remains an AI infrastructure beneficiary as storage and memory shortages lift supplier pricing, extend the cycle, and force customers like Apple, Microsoft and Lenovo to absorb higher costs. The better bull voices lean fundamental, though several trend-following posts are after-the-fact recaps rather than fresh underwrite.
Key voicesBears focus on exhausted post-earnings momentum, crowded memory positioning, and a clear late-week technical break below key moving averages. The camp has credible technical contributors, but the most explicit short call comes from a cold low-medium credibility trader.
